通过AI实时语音技术实现语音密码验证的步骤

在数字化时代,信息安全成为每个人都必须关注的问题。随着科技的不断发展,人工智能(AI)技术逐渐渗透到我们生活的方方面面。其中,AI实时语音技术作为一种新型生物识别技术,被广泛应用于各类安全认证系统中。本文将讲述一位IT工程师如何利用AI实时语音技术实现语音密码验证的故事。

李明是一位年轻的IT工程师,在一家知名科技公司担任网络安全研究员。他热衷于探索新技术,希望通过创新的方式提升信息安全防护水平。在一次偶然的机会,李明了解到AI实时语音技术在语音密码验证领域的应用,这让他眼前一亮。

李明意识到,传统的密码验证方式存在诸多弊端,如密码容易被破解、用户易忘记密码等。而AI实时语音技术能够通过识别用户的语音特征,实现更安全、便捷的验证过程。于是,他决定着手研究这一技术,并将其应用到公司的语音密码验证系统中。

以下是李明通过AI实时语音技术实现语音密码验证的步骤:

一、收集语音样本

为了训练AI模型,李明首先需要收集大量用户的语音样本。他选取了公司内部200名员工作为测试对象,要求每位员工分别录制3次不同场景下的语音样本,包括工作、休息、户外等。这些样本将作为AI模型的训练数据。

二、预处理语音数据

收集到语音样本后,李明对数据进行预处理,包括降噪、静音检测、分割等。这些预处理步骤有助于提高后续模型训练和识别的准确性。

三、特征提取

在预处理完成后,李明从每个语音样本中提取关键特征。这些特征包括音调、音量、音速、音长、音质等。通过提取这些特征,AI模型可以更好地识别用户的语音。

四、构建语音识别模型

接下来,李明利用提取的特征构建语音识别模型。他选择了深度学习中的卷积神经网络(CNN)和循环神经网络(RNN)作为基础模型。通过对模型的不断优化和调整,李明成功地训练出了一个能够识别用户语音的AI模型。

五、语音密码验证系统设计

在构建好语音识别模型后,李明开始设计语音密码验证系统。该系统主要包括以下功能:

  1. 用户注册:用户在注册时,需要录制一段包含特定密码的语音样本,并将其存储在服务器上。

  2. 登录验证:用户在登录时,系统会播放一段预设的密码语音,要求用户按照提示复述密码。

  3. 语音识别:系统接收到用户的复述后,将语音数据输入到AI模型中进行识别。

  4. 验证结果:若识别结果与存储在服务器上的语音样本一致,则验证成功;否则,验证失败。

六、测试与优化

为了确保语音密码验证系统的可靠性,李明在200名员工中进行了测试。测试结果表明,该系统在识别准确率、抗噪能力、误识率等方面均表现良好。然而,也存在一些不足之处,如部分用户在复述密码时语音不够清晰,导致识别失败。针对这些问题,李明对AI模型和系统进行了优化。

七、推广应用

经过测试和优化后,李明将语音密码验证系统在公司内部推广应用。用户纷纷表示,相较于传统密码验证方式,语音密码验证更加便捷、安全。此外,该系统还适用于远程登录、支付验证等领域,具有广泛的应用前景。

总结:

李明通过AI实时语音技术实现语音密码验证的过程,充分展示了科技创新在提升信息安全防护水平方面的巨大潜力。在未来,随着AI技术的不断进步,相信更多类似的应用将涌现,为我们的生活带来更多便利和安全保障。

猜你喜欢:AI客服